I want to get into level design, as someone who is already in industry. How and where to start designing levels? by -Kemy in leveldesign

[–]Classic_DM 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Unreal 5. Work through technical tutorials by Magnet x on you tube and Epic's free courses.

https://www.unrealengine.com/news/free-professional-unreal-engine-courses-now-available-on-the-epic-developer-community

Mod existing games to sharpen game play ideation and creation.

Buy Francis DK Ching's Book. Form, Space, and Order.

Pour your soul into this and self publish environments on FAB or mod communities.
